Closed Bug 315962 Opened 19 years ago Closed 17 years ago

Add Lightning buttons to Thunderbird toolbar by default

Categories

(Calendar :: Lightning Only, defect)

defect
Not set
normal

Tracking

(Not tracked)

VERIFIED INVALID

People

(Reporter: dmosedale, Unassigned)

References

Details

Attachments

(1 file)

In addition to packaging the images, we may want to add some or all of these buttons to the toolbar by default.
*** Bug 315961 has been marked as a duplicate of this bug. ***
Attached patch overlay customizeToolbar.xul — — Splinter Review
All of the actual packaging, etc already seems to be in place.  If I drag a button to the toolbar, then a nice icon shows up without a problem.  The only bug I found was that icons don't show up inside the actual customize toolbar window.  This patch adds an overlay to that xul file so that the css rules can be applied.
Assignee: nobody → jminta
Status: NEW → ASSIGNED
Attachment #205479 - Flags: first-review?(dmose)
Comment on attachment 205479 [details] [diff] [review]
overlay customizeToolbar.xul

I'd suggest switching from <overlay></overlay> to <overlay/>.  r=dmose with or without that change.
Attachment #205479 - Flags: first-review?(dmose) → first-review+
Comment on attachment 205479 [details] [diff] [review]
overlay customizeToolbar.xul

patch checked in, leaving bug open for adding buttons to the toolbar by default.  Suggestions as to what those buttons should be?
Setting this back to default to try and unload a bit of my assigned bugs.  Anyone interested in working on the remaining part of this should look at http://forums.mozillazine.org/viewtopic.php?t=189667 (scroll down several comments).
Assignee: jminta → nobody
Status: ASSIGNED → NEW
Whiteboard: [good first bug]
(In reply to comment #5)
> Setting this back to default to try and unload a bit of my assigned bugs. 
> Anyone interested in working on the remaining part of this should look at
> http://forums.mozillazine.org/viewtopic.php?t=189667

Joey, what do you think of this: 
http://forums.mozillazine.org/viewtopic.php?p=1105811#1105811
(In reply to comment #6)
> (In reply to comment #5)
> > Setting this back to default to try and unload a bit of my assigned bugs. 
> > Anyone interested in working on the remaining part of this should look at
> > http://forums.mozillazine.org/viewtopic.php?t=189667
> 
> Joey, what do you think of this: 
> http://forums.mozillazine.org/viewtopic.php?p=1105811#1105811
> 

While that poster's logic is reasonable, the number of people who customize their toolbar is likely to be exceedingly small (ie only a fraction of power users).  I would suggest that the case to optimize for is the vast majority / non power-user.  So if we think that discoverability / convenience is given a good enough boost by putting it in the toolbar by default (and I kinda suspect it is), I think leaving the power users to tweak anything they don't like is the right thing to do.
This shouldn't really block 0.1; the current state may be ugly, but it's usable.
No longer blocks: lightning-0.1
Update summary to reflect remaining issues.
Summary: icons for lightning toolbar icons should be packaged → Add Lightning buttons to Thunderbird toolbar by default
*** Bug 356828 has been marked as a duplicate of this bug. ***
Depends on: 327780
This bug is invalid with checkin of patch from bug 371916. -> Nominating for marking INVALID.
Whiteboard: [good first bug]
Status: NEW → RESOLVED
Closed: 17 years ago
Resolution: --- → INVALID
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: